Born November 2, 1945, in Groveland, Georgia, Larry Little, the great NFL offensive tackle, played college football for Bethune-Cookman College in Daytona Beach, Florida, where he was an All-Conference player. The Pro Football Hall of Fame’s website bio reports that Little was an unheralded undrafted free pick-up by the San Diego Chargers in 1967. After a couple of seasons with the Chargers, they traded his rights to the Miami Dolphins, and that is when Larry’s career really turned to the positive. With Miami, he became a dominant blocker for the powerful Dolphin teams of the early 1970s, including the undefeated Super Bowl Champion team of 1972, a game where the Phins rushed for 2960 yards! Larry Little earned the award of being the NFL Player’s Association’s AFC Lineman of the Year in 3 consecutive seasons of 1970, 1971 & 1972. The great blocker played a total of 14 NFL seasons, made the Pro Bowl 6 times, and was an NFL All-Pro 6 times, too. The Pro Football Hall of Fame enshrined Larry Little in 1993.
